Well! Polypeptides are chain of amino-acids better known as proteins. Those amino-acids are join together by peptide bonds. Peptide bonds form when two amino-acids undego the process of condensation reaction, or dehydration synthesis where a carboxyl group of one amino-acid reacts with the amino group of another amino acid releasing water.
